Five men, from Huddersfield and Sheffield, are jailed for sexually abusing a teenager.
BBC News
The men, who abused a girl between 2005 and 2010, were sentenced at Bradford Crown Court on Thursday.A West Yorkshire Police operation has investigated child sexual abuse in Huddersfield with offences spanning a period from 1995 to 2013. It followed the abuse of a young girl in the Huddersfield area between 2005 and 2010 with the abuse starting when the victim was just 14 years old.
Nahman Mohammed, 37, from Huddersfield, sentenced to seven years. Convicted of two rape offences and trafficking for sexual exploitation
